Cane Bay is on a five-game streak of home wins, while Fort Dorchester is on a three-game streak of away wins: one of those streaks is about to end. The Cobras will host the Patriots at 5:30 p.m. on Monday. Both come into the contest b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
On Wednesday, Cane Bay got the win against Stall by a conclusive 3-0.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-6, 25-17, 25-12.
Meanwhile, Fort Dorchester faced St. James in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Saturday. The Patriots came out on top against the Sharks by a score of 2-0.
The 2-0 score doesn't really reflect how close the match was: every set was decided by three points or less. The final score came out to 30-28, 25-23.
Cane Bay's win bumped their record up to 8-3. As for Fort Dorchester, their victory bumped their record up to 18-12.
Cane Bay beat Fort Dorchester 2-0 in their previous matchup two weeks ago. Will the Cobras repeat their success, or do the Patriots have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
